Aquarium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ak, contained within the aquarium | Yes | No | You can handle it yourself with basic tools and equipment. |
| Large leak, spreading to surrounding areas | No | Yes | You need specialized equipment and expertise to contain the damage. |
| Water damage to walls, floors, or ceilings | No | Yes | You need professional help to assess and repair the damage. |
| Mold growth on belongings or in the aquarium | No | Yes | You need professional help to remove the mold and prevent further growth. |
| Unpleasant odors or sounds from the aquarium | No | Yes | You need professional help to identify and address the underlying issue. |
| Unknown source of the leak or water damage | No | Yes | You need professional help to investigate and find the source of the problem. |

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ost in Northeast Boise, ID
The cost of aquarium le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Northeast Boise, ID. These estimates are based on our experience and may vary depending on your specific situation. Get a free estimate from our team today.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water extracted.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ment used. |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air. |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of mold growth. |
| Equipment rental and usage | $100 – $500 | The type and duration of equipment rental. |
| Travel and labor costs | $200 – $1,000 | The distance and time required for travel and labor. |
